My Hitachi 50SBX70B lost power within seconds of plugging in, all the green LED's lit for a flash then went out slowly. Only the Red LED (D912) labeled Protect LED is blinking. I checked pico fuse E994 and it's OK, also C701 seems to be OK since I don't see any burn marks.

Symptom: BLOWS E994
Cause: DEFECTIVE D604
Symptom: BLOWS I401 EVERY FEW WEEKS
Cause: DEFECTIVE C410
Symptom: DARK PICTURE
Cause: DEFECTIVE 3D/YC COMB FILTER
Symptom: DARK PICTURE
Cause: DEFECTIVE C724
Symptom: DIGITAL CONVERGENCE WON'T ADJUST
Cause: DEFECTIVE DCU
Symptom: E994 KEEPS BLOWING
Cause: DEFECTIVE C701
Symptom: INTERMITTENT COLOR ON ALL INPUTS
Cause: DEFECTIVE IY01
Symptom: INTERMITTENT REMOTE FUNCTIONS
Cause: DEFECTIVE IR HM01
Symptom: INTERMITTENT REMOTE FUNCTIONS
Cause: DEFECTIVE D029
Symptom: INTERMITTENT VIDEO
Cause: DEFECTIVE 3D/YC COMB FILTER
Symptom: LOSS OF SYNC
Cause: DEFECTIVE 3D/YC COMB FILTER
Symptom: NO AUDIO
Cause: NEED TO RESET EEPROM I004
Symptom: NO CLOCK/SLOW CLOCK/CAN'T ADJUST CLOCK
Cause: DEFECTIVE D031,R0H8,Q018
Symptom: NO CONTROL OF BLUE COLOR
Cause: DEFECTIVE D511
Symptom: NO FRONT CONTROLS FUNCTIONS/REMOTE OK
Cause: DEFECTIVE DM04
Symptom: NO HOR SYNC
Cause: DEFECTIVE I008
Symptom: No Horizontal Sync. When PinP is called up, main picture may lock up for a 8 moment, then it goes back out of sync.
Cause: I008 defective (Sync Switch)
Symptom: NO LEFT CHANNEL
Cause: DEFECTIVE I401
Symptom: NO OSD
Cause: DEFECTIVE D716
Symptom: NO OSD
Cause: DEFECTIVE I102
Symptom: NO PICTURE
Cause: DEFECTIVE 3D/YC COMB FILTER
Symptom: NO POWER
Cause: DEFECTIVE I912
Symptom: NO REAR AUDIO
Cause: DEFECTIVE IS11
Symptom: NO REMOTE FUNCTIONE/FRONT CONTROLS OK
Cause: DEFECTIVE IR HM01
Symptom: NO REMOTE FUNCTIONS/FRONT CONTROLS OK
Cause: DEFECTIVE DM11
Symptom: NO SOUND
Cause: DEFECTIVE I401
Symptom: NO TUNER AND ALL INPUTS
Cause: DEFECTIVE IYO1
Symptom: OSD LATCHUP
Cause: SEE PTV98-4B
Symptom: PICTURE PULLS
Cause: DEFECTIVE D702,D703,D704
Symptom: RANDOM CHARACTERS ON SCREEN
Cause: NEED TO RESET EEPROM I004
Symptom: REPLACED DCU/RECONVERGED/NO MAGIC FOCUS
Cause: DID NOT INITIALIZE SENSORS
Symptom: RK46 VERY HOT/STK'S HAVE BEEN REPLACED
Cause: DEFECTIVE DCU
Symptom: SHUTDOWN
Cause: DEFECTIVE I401
Symptom: SHUTDOWN
Cause: DEFECTIVE I601
Symptom: SHUTDOWN
Cause: DEFECTIVE C715
Symptom: SHUTDOWN/OPEN E995,E996
Cause: DEFECTIVE T702
Symptom: SMEARED PICTURE
Cause: DEFECTIVE 3D/YC COMB FILTER
Symptom: SNAPS/BLOWS Q777
Cause: CRT ARCING
Symptom: WEAK COLOR
Cause: DEFECTIVE 3D/YC COMB FILTER
Symptom: WON'T HOLD CHANNEL MEMORY
Cause: NEED TO RESET EEPROM I004
Symptom: WON'T HOLD CHANNEL MEMORY
Cause: DEFECTIVE EEPROM I004
Symptom: NO AUDIO
Cause: Q013
Symptom: SHUTDOWN
Cause: Q777,I901
Symptom: SHUTDOWN
Cause: E994,D724

The condition of your TV called power supply overcurrent shutdown. The TV is going into a protection mode to prevent further circuit damage. That's why it will not turn on or not powering up,only a red standby light. I would concentrate on the power supply section board. Bad regulation of the incoming voltage could caused this issue although,there is a capacitor across the incoming line and nuetral.Maybe its leak or dry up and cause the problems,change it out with one of identical rating .I would probably also check the flyback circuit and flyback transformer although now you are getting into dangerous area,especially if you have no electronic experience background. It could be also be a loose ,crack or cold solder joint,a blown fuse,fusible links or other component .It could be one of several boards.Unfortunately the level of sophistication on these TV make it virtually impossible to diagnose them further without taking them apart and probing around with a multimeter and other tools.

If the red led is on, then are not the capacitors on the power board. You need to troubleshoot the problem testing components one by one.
This is the part of the diagram for your situation, when red is on and green off:
Test filter coil Q914, and proceed from there, that is what you need to do.
To test the filter coil, you short it, If you still get no picture you test voltage at Q701, must be 0.3v, then follow instructions on components to be tested.

Well, I followed the troubleshooting flowchart on pages 32-33 as you suggested and my problem seems to be on the (A) path. The voltage at pin 5 of I901 is not right (-42V instead of +10V to +16V). Then I proceeded to check the 5 components it suggested and pretty sure that R905/906 and D907 are OK, not 100% sure about Q901 and C907 (don't know how to check them on PWB). The problem is fixed by repair service. According to the repair description, it was cold soldered joints on main PCB.
